Strawberry Quick Bread with Fresh Berries

Ingredients

Scale
  • ¾ cup Sugar
  • ½ cup Milk
  • ½ cup Oil
  • 2 Eggs
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la
  • 1 ½ cups Flour
  • 1 ½ teaspoons Baking powder
  • ¼ teaspoon Salt
  • 1 ½ cups Diced strawberries (fresh or thawed)
  • 2 Tablespoons All-purpose flour (for coating strawberries)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×5 inch loaf pan.
  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together sugar, milk, oil, eggs, and vanilla until combined.
  3. In another bowl, mix flour, baking powder, and salt.
  4. Add dry ingredients to the wet mixture; stir gently until just combined.
  5. Toss diced strawberries in the additional flour and fold them into the batter carefully.
  6.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and bake for about 55 to 60 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  7. Allow cooling before slicing.
